Why respite care matters more than families realize?

Caregiver burnout isn’t a personal failure — it’s a predictable physical and emotional response to an unsustainable workload:

  • Family caregivers die earlier than non-caregivers at similar ages, with mortality rates up to 63% higher
  • Depression rates among family caregivers reach 40–70%, especially among those caring for dementia patients
  • Chronic health conditions develop faster in long-term caregivers — heart disease, diabetes, and weakened immune systems
  • Marriage and family relationships suffer when one member carries the full caregiving load
  • Quality of care declines when caregivers are exhausted — even the most loving family member can’t provide attentive care on zero rest

Taking a break doesn’t mean you love your family member less. It means you’re building a caregiving approach you can actually sustain.

What Respite Care includes:

When our respite caregiver steps in, your loved one receives the same full range of care you’ve been providing:

Personal care during respite:

  • Bathing, dressing, grooming, and hygiene support
  • Toileting and incontinence care
  • Mobility assistance and safe transfers
  • Meal preparation and feeding support
  • Medication reminders

Companionship & supervision:

  • One-on-one engagement and conversation
  • Activities, hobbies, and mental stimulation
  • Safe supervision for clients with dementia or cognitive concerns
  • Reassurance and emotional support

Home and routine continuity:

  • Following your loved one’s existing daily routine
  • Light housekeeping and laundry
  • Managing the household the way you would
  • Communication with family members as needed

Extended respite options:

  • Short hourly respite (4–8 hours at a time)
  • Full-day respite (12+ hours)
  • Overnight respite
  • Weekend respite
  • Vacation coverage (multi-day or weeklong care)

A lot of respite care happens on paper — families book hours, show up, and end up hovering anxiously the entire time because they don’t quite trust the caregiver to handle things. That’s not respite. That’s babysitting the babysitter.

Our approach is different. We take the time upfront to learn your loved one’s full care plan, routines, preferences, and quirks. We send detailed intake questionnaires, meet your loved one before the first visit, and maintain consistent caregiver assignment so the same familiar face returns each time. By the second or third respite visit, most families tell us they actually exhale — and that’s when respite does its real work.
